Logo
Graid Technology Inc.

Senior Software Engineer

Graid Technology Inc., WorkFromHome

Save Job

Do you want to work for one of the hottest storage startups? Due to recent success, Graid Technology is looking to add to their R&D team in the US.

This role entails working in the office a few days per week as necessary in our Santa Clara office.

Role Description

We are looking for a Northern California located software engineer to join our growing R&D team in the U.S. This is a full-time role for a software development professional at Graid Technology. The role will involve daily tasks such as developing, building, and maintaining our cutting-edge GPU-based software for data storage. This position will report to the Head of U.S. Engineering.

Responsibilities

  • Complete software development process including requirement analysis, design, development, deployment, and support
  • Implement unit test automation for added features
  • Identify performance bottlenecks and continuously implement improvements
  • Collaborate with other cross functional teams, including those in a different time zone
  • Participate in design and QA test plan reviews
  • Support critical customer escalations and provide root cause analysis in a timely manner
  • Work with multi-functional team members on user requirements, including but not limited to : product management, QA, customer support.

Qualifications

  • Bachelor's degree in Computer Science or related field; or equivalent education
  • 5+ years of experience in software development
  • Experience with C / C++, Python, Golang, and Linux and other related programming languages
  • In-depth understanding of CPU architecture, computer architecture, operating systems and data structures
  • Experience with Debugging and performance optimization, i.e. ability to use tools such as gdb, WinDBG, and perf
  • Knowledge of multithreading and lockless algorithms
  • Organized, analytical, creative and adaptive in approach and finding solutions
  • Ability to work independently and remotely or as part of a team
  • Desired Skills

  • Relevant engineering experience with the field of data storage or related technologies
  • Experience with kernel programming is a plus
  • Experience in GPU programming models such as CUDA or similar is a plus
  • Knowledge of SDS, ASIC, or storage technology
  • Experienced with kernel level programming
  • Company Description

    Graid Technology is a cutting-edge data storage company focused on protecting NVMe-based data with its innovative SupremeRAID GPU-based RAID technology. Our innovative solution delivers world-record performance while increasing scalability, improving flexibility, and lowering the total cost of ownership. Headquartered in Silicon Valley with a strong R&D center in Taiwan, we lead advancements in storage solutions for various industries including AI, high-performance computing, video production, and healthcare.

    Salary Range

    The total compensation range for this role is $180k - $250k a year. The range displayed on this job posting reflects a minimum and maximum target. Individual pay is determined by work location and additional factors, including job-related skills, experience, and relevant education or training.

    Non-Discriminatory Policy :

    Graid Technology Inc. does not and shall not discriminate on the basis of race, color, religion (creed), gender, gender expression, age, national origin (ancestry), disability, marital status, sexual orientation, or military status, in any of its activities or operations.

    Seniority level

    Seniority level

    Mid-Senior level

    Employment type

    Employment type

    Full-time

    Job function

    Job function

    Engineering and Information Technology

    Industries

    IT Services and IT Consulting

    Referrals increase your chances of interviewing at Graid Technology Inc. by 2x

    Sign in to set job alerts for "Senior Software Engineer" roles.

    Sunnyvale, CA $150,000.00-$158,000.00 58 minutes ago

    Mountain View, CA $145,000.00-$170,000.00 4 days ago

    Mountain View, CA $138,225.00-$207,575.00 5 days ago

    Software Engineer, AI Platform - New Grad

    Mountain View, CA $145,000.00-$170,000.00 4 days ago

    Software Engineer (L4), Content & Business Products

    San Jose, CA $100,500.00-$173,250.00 1 week ago

    Palo Alto, CA $140,000.00-$185,000.00 2 weeks ago

    Mountain View, CA $130,000.00-$176,000.00 3 weeks ago

    San Jose, CA $113,400.00-$206,300.00 1 week ago

    Software Engineer (L5) - Open Connect Platform

    San Francisco Bay Area $160,000.00-$180,000.00 13 hours ago

    San Jose, CA $113,400.00-$206,300.00 1 week ago

    San Jose, CA $100,500.00-$173,250.00 3 weeks ago

    San Jose, CA $93,200.00-$170,600.00 5 days ago

    San Jose, CA $113,400.00-$206,300.00 1 week ago

    Software Engineer, Google Store, Front End

    Mountain View, CA $141,000.00-$202,000.00 2 weeks ago

    San Jose, CA $113,400.00-$206,300.00 5 days ago

    eCommerce Full Stack Developer (React / Shopify) - On Site

    San Jose, CA $113,400.00-$206,300.00 1 week ago

    Menlo Park, CA $157,000.00-$230,000.00 2 weeks ago

    San Jose, CA $113,400.00-$206,300.00 1 week ago

    We're un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.

    J-18808-Ljbffr

    #J-18808-Ljbffr